What Are Preventive Diagnostics?
Preventive diagnostics involve medical assessments designed to identify disease risk factors, physiological imbalances, and biological aging patterns before symptoms appear. Longevity clinics use these diagnostics to create individualized health optimization programs that support healthy aging and long-term wellness.
Common preventive diagnostic services include:
- Comprehensive blood testing
- Biomarker analysis
- Genetic and genomic screening
- Epigenetic age assessment
- Cardiovascular risk evaluation
- Metabolic health testing
- Hormone analysis
- Nutritional deficiency testing
- Inflammatory marker monitoring

Technologies Driving Preventive Diagnostics
Artificial Intelligence
AI helps analyze complex diagnostic data, identify patterns, predict disease risk, and personalize preventive interventions.
Genomics and Epigenetics
Genetic testing identifies inherited health risks, while epigenetic analysis measures biological aging and the effects of lifestyle and environmental factors.
Wearable Health Monitoring
Continuous tracking of sleep, heart rate variability, glucose levels, activity, and stress provides additional data for personalized preventive care.
Digital Health Platforms
Remote monitoring and telemedicine enable ongoing diagnostic review and treatment optimization without frequent clinic visits.
